A court in the Central African Republic sentenced former military ruler Andre Kolingba and 21 others to death in absentia for their part in an attempted coup last year. Around 600 others, mainly soldiers, were also sentenced in absentia to up to 20 years in prison after a two-day trial in which they had no legal representation. The mass trial followed Kolingba's attempt in May 2001 to overthrow President Ange Felix Patasse, the man who won elections in 1993 to end Kolingba's 12-year rule. Kolingba's attempt to seize back power sparked bloody street fighting in the capital Bangui, which forced tens of thousands of residents from their homes and was only put down with the help of Libyan troops. The official death toll following the attempted coup was 59, though residents say many more died. "We note with bitterness that while the rest of the world moving towards abolishing the death penalty here the courts are handing down death sentences," lawyer Lambert Zokwezo, chairman of the Central African Human Rights Observatory, told Reuters. "People must realise the number of anomalies in this hearing," Zokwezo added, saying that some of those sentenced were known to have died in exile, while at least one of those judged in absentia was in fact already in detention.
